Sema only mimick GLP-1 (Glucagon-like peptide 1)(read: is an agonist).
Tirz mimick both GIP (Glucose-dependent insulinotropic polypeptide) and GLP-1 (in a ration of 9:1). (contains two agonists).

GIP actually release more Glucagon as a sideeffect; but it releases even more insulin, so tirz still works.

Glucagon is a bit complicated (it does several things) but its basically the opposite of insulin (insulin lowers blood glucose and Glucagon raises it).

So in Reta they added a glucagon antagonist to the mix, that works by blocking the action of glucagon at its receptor. This means it prevents glucagon from binding to its receptor and exerting its effects, which lead to a decrease in blood sugar levels compared to tirz.

All of this is theory obviously.

Glucagon does not cause muscle loss if not in a hypoglycemic state and even in that state it first uses glycogen storage. So no blocking glucagon receptor would not be beneficial and can actually hurt since it's necessary to keep blood glucose stable during exercise.
